2025 – 2006 · AnnualRevenue history
| Fiscal year end | Revenue |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| $3.37B | +$0.39B | +13.09% |
| 2024-12-31 | $2.98B | +$1.61B | +116.49% |
| 2023-12-31 | $1.38B | +$0.97B | +241.04% |
| 2022-12-31 | $0.40B | -$0.06B | -13.67% |
| 2021-12-31 | $0.47B | -$0.07B | -12.24% |
| 2020-12-31 | $0.53B | -$0.11B | -16.78% |
| 2019-12-31 | $0.64B | -$0.05B | -7.85% |
| 2018-12-31 | $0.70B | -$0.08B | -10.02% |
| 2017-12-31 | $0.77B | -$0.26B | -24.97% |
| 2016-12-31 | $1.03B | +$0.00B | +0.25% |

About Revenue & Reporting
Revenue (also called sales, net sales, or turnover) is the total income Red Sea International Company receives from its business operations before deducting any costs or expenses. It is the top line of the income statement. Unlike net income or earnings, revenue does not account for operating costs, taxes, interest, or depreciation.
